I used the Imagine and Best Friends cartridge. I printed out the cardstock on two white pages of cardstock. I printed out the kite at fit to page and the two girls are at 3.8". How to make it:
1. Pick a leaf from the Mother's Day Cartridge and what I did was on each page I used filled page with the leaves 1 at 2 inches, 1 @ 1.5" and 2 @ 1".
2. Next I took the thin piece of 8.5x8.5 paper and covered it with adhedsive.
3. Take the 2" leaves and start covering/ layering them on the bottom of the paper, I did about 4 layers. Repeat with the 1.5" leaves and then with the 1" ones up to the top of the page this makes the bottom half of the dress (skirt)
4. Next take the skirt and wrap it around the wire form. I have to add some flowers to the edges of the skirt to get it to fit around the wire. Then I used the glue gun to glue the skirt together at the edges.
5. Then I used the glue gun to add more of the 1" leaves to the top of the form to make the dress top.
6. I added some bling as a necklace with my i-rock.
